Visited on 8 April 2011 with six well oiled friends. Overall we were happy with our Gori experience, not wowed, but we enjoyed our night with good food, wine and service. You might wonder why I did not rate it higher than a 3. Well it's hard to explain really, perhaps a 3.5 stars would be fairer, but all of us struggled with the menu.

I know this sounds like I've been watching too many Gordon Ramsey re-runs, but when the menu spans so many styles from East to West, with pictures and all, you're left a bit daunted in the choice department, and some questions - can they really cook all the dishes on the menu well?. I struggled to find something I actually wanted to eat (despite the extensive menu), eventually settling for a steak in wine stew.

On the good side, the ambience is modern and airey, the house red at 120 RMB a bottle was very acceptable, and the extensive choice of bottled wine on display is very cool. The staff were prompt and friendly, and when the food came out most were very happy or happy with their meals. My steak stew can be recommended, although I think the cold potato salad would be better as hot mashed potato. Anyhow, the meat was the king of night, tender and tasty so well done chefs.

Would go again, good for groups as the seating area is generous.
